GRB 090424 : TAOS optical detection

Y. Urata, Z.W. Zhang, C.Y. Wen, K.Y. Huang, S.Y. Wang and the TAOS
team

Three 50cm TAOS telescopes, located at Lulin observatory, Taiwan,
started to observe GRB 090424 field (Cannizzo et al.; GCN 9223) at 94s
after the trigger. The optical afterglow (Yuan et al., GCN 9224; Xin
et al. GCN 9225) was clearly detected in images taken by TAOSA (25s
exposure), TAOSB (5s exposure), and TAOSD (1s exposure). Brightness of
the afterglow is about R~13.08 at 94s post the burst. Our R-band
magnitude were calibrated with USNOB red stars.
